How do you ask if you should attend a meeting?

One way of wording your inquiry might be: Thank you for the timetable. Would you like me to attend all the meetings? That leaves your boss with the options of saying that the timetable was just for your information and that you need not attend; or specifying which meetings you should attend.

What factors determine who should be invited to participate in the meeting?

Those who will be directly affected by things discussed or decided during the meeting. Those who need to quickly execute things discussed or decided. People who have something to say about the matters to be discussed. People who have special knowledge or information about the matters to be discussed.

What are the three most important roles in a meeting?

The leader, reporter, timekeeper, and participant are four basic roles any effective meeting should have. You can assign each to separate participants, or combine two or more roles into one. Regardless, make sure each person performing their duties has adequate resources, training and time to do an effective job.

How can I get included in important meetings?

Ask your boss if there are projects you can work on that would help you be included in those meetings. If your boss agrees that you should be included in future meetings, don’t be bashful about reminding them about that commitment.
